Abstract

Mineral deposits rarely occur in isolation.

Many world-class districts contain multiple generations of mineralization associated with inherited structures, fluid pathways, lithological boundaries, and crustal architecture.

This paper evaluates inheritance as a central concept in mineral system analysis.
